Am I Missing a bracket?

this may seam like a weird question but not sure if im missing a bracket for my ashtray in my 71 f250. the tray is intact but falls out of dash if u bounce enough the in dash structure is there too. but i think im missing some sort of slider bracket that fits between inner structure and tray. reason i think that is because there is groves in the tray that don't match up to inner dash tack. thinking im missing a middle piece that uses ball bearings to guide the ash tray. id take a picture to show but i don't have the truck right now, it is in the shop having trans rebuilt. it has been over a month since it went in shop. wish i was still able to do repairs my self but this was over my head anyways. im trying to figure out how to fix the ashtray if i can. payday is coming up on 3rd so maybe i can afford to buy from a club member if they have one.

1968/72 ashtray rides on (4) 354872-S ball bearings, (2 per side) which "go away" causing tray to flop around within receptacle. 1967's use a different ashtray, no ball bearings.

My 70 f-100 looks like the one on the right. It has a clip that goes on the bottom of the piece with the slots in it. Goes underneath that piece and up the sides them holds 2 steel ***** on each side so the ash tray can move. Look at the junkyard just make sure the holes on clip are not wore out. Mine were that's why I had to replace the clip.

If yours has the clip the holes are most like wore out and the steel ***** have fallen out.
